The Value of Your Windshield
Before diving into what occurs when you drive with a broken windscreen, it's beneficial to understand its functions. A windshield serves several crucial functions:
Structural Support: It assists keep the vehicle's structure, especially in rollover accidents. Safety Features: Modern lorries typically use sophisticated driver-assistance systems (ADAS) that count on video cameras and sensing units installed on or near the windshield. Protection from Debris: It shields residents from wind, rain, and debris while driving.Given these functions, a jeopardized windshield can position risks not only to the chauffeur however to guests and other roadway users.
Types of Cracks and Their Implications
Windshield fractures can differ substantially in size and type. Understanding these differences is necessary for examining whether you need repair or replacement.
- Star Cracks: These are small cracks that radiate from a central impact point. While they may seem minor, they can spread quickly under temperature level modifications or stress. Bullseye Cracks: Similar to star fractures however normally larger and more circular, bullseye fractures compromise presence more noticeably. Edge Cracks: These take place at the edge of the glass and can deteriorate the total integrity of the windshield. Long Cracks: Any crack longer than 6 inches is generally beyond repair and demands replacement.
Each type has its own set of dangers connected with it. For example, star fractures may be repairable if captured early, while long fractures typically warrant instant replacement.
Risks Related to Driving on a Split Windshield
Continuing to drive with a split windshield exposes you to several dangers:
Reduced Visibility
A crack can distort your view of the roadway ahead, specifically if it blocks your line of vision. This distortion can make it tough to see pedestrians or other cars plainly, increasing the likelihood of accidents.
Compromised Structural Integrity
In an accident situation, a broken windscreen might not offer appropriate assistance throughout effects or rollovers. The failure of this element might result in increased injury risk for all occupants in the vehicle.
Legal Implications
In many jurisdictions, driving with a risky car protests the law. A noticeably split windshield can draw in fines or charges during traffic stops or inspections.
Increased Repair Costs
Ignoring a small fracture now might cause more extensive damage later. A minor repair work might escalate into a costly replacement if not https://telegra.ph/Area-Guide-Windshield-Repair-in-Mission-Valley-San-Diego-03-08 dealt with promptly.
Potential for More Damage
Environmental aspects like temperature variations can intensify existing fractures, triggering them to spread rapidly. This potential for development implies that what starts as a little inconvenience could rapidly become an urgent issue.
Signs It's Time for Replacement
Recognizing when it's time for a complete replacement rather than simply repair work is essential. Here are some indicators:
- The crack is longer than 6 inches. There are multiple cracks in various areas. The damage lies directly in your line of sight. The crack has spread over time despite previous repairs.
If any of these conditions use, consulting with a professional about changing your windshield becomes imperative.
The Replacement Process Explained
Should you discover yourself needing a new windshield, comprehending what happens during replacement can alleviate some issues:
Assessment: A technician will examine the level of damage and talk about options. Removal: The old windshield is thoroughly eliminated without harmful surrounding components. Preparation: Surface areas are cleaned thoroughly before using adhesive for the brand-new glass. Installation: The brand-new windscreen is set into location utilizing top quality adhesive created for structural integrity. Curing Time: You'll generally require to wait numerous hours before driving again; this permits adhesive to bond properly.Most specialists advise having replacements done by qualified technicians due to their proficiency and access to quality materials.
Cost Considerations
The expense connected with replacing a broken windscreen differs widely based upon several factors consisting of:
- Vehicle make and model Type of glass used Labor expenses in your area Advanced functions like heating elements or built-in sensors
Generally speaking, anticipate to pay anywhere from $200-$1,000 depending on these variables. It's useful to get several quotes from different service providers before deciding where to go.

When Repairs Make Sense
While it's essential not to neglect damage totally, sometimes repair work are viable options instead of complete replacements:
- Small chips normally less than one inch in diameter often qualify for repair if caught early enough. Repairs take considerably less time than full replacements-- typically within 30 minutes-- making them convenient for busy schedules.
However, constantly talk to professionals who can offer guidance tailored particularly to your scenario relating to repair work versus replacements.
